Firefox randomly switches to dark mode (Fennec for Android)

Sometimes I use the browser while the system is in dark mode. Then I switch system to light mode. FF recognizes it and switches to light mode accordingly. Then I … (Lesen Sie mehr)

  1. Sometimes I use the browser while the system is in dark mode.
  2. Then I switch system to light mode. FF recognizes it and switches to light mode accordingly.
  3. Then I use it in light mode for a little more.
  4. Then some time passes (maybe a few hours), I don't use FF during that time.
  5. Then, I tap on FF icon, the browser starts, but immediately switches back to dark mode, while the system is still in light mode.
  6. I have to close FF by swiping on it in task switcher, and then tap on the app again.
  7. FF now uses light/dark theme according to system.

Device: Motorola Edge 30 Neo with stock Android 14.

I am using Fennec: 124.1.0 (Build #1241020), 516df33ca9+ GV: 124.0.1-20240326023132 AS: 124.0
